Poor Muncie, Ind. A small city in that mythical region called the heartland, it has been probed, inspected and all but dissected for more than half a century, labeled by teams of social scientists as typically American. The husband-and-wife team of Robert and Helen Lynd led off in 1929 with their famous book Middletown: A Study in American Culture, following up eight years later with Middletown in Transition: A Study in Cultural Conflicts.
